ORIGINAL: Lordgunner

Alright, thanks a lot for the info.

Not to sound like amoron, but say if I did DPMS model that was $670 and I eventually wanted to used for varmins, predators, deer, ect. I could buy a different upper receiver that was capable of mounting a scope on it and put that on my lower receiver?

Also, does $670 seem like a good deal, or are there better deals to be found?
You are correct on the upper deal. There are just 2 pins that hold the upper to the lower. You can own one lower and 20 uppers if you want. Takes 10 seconds to change.

You mentioned for deer. I think the lowers made to handle the biggerrounds like the 243, 260 and such are made differently like the AR-10.That is unless you mean using the 223 for deer usingsomething like a TSX or something.

ORIGINAL: Miket_81



You are correct on the upper deal. There are just 2 pins that hold the upper to the lower. You can own one lower and 20 uppers if you want. Takes 10 seconds to change.

You mentioned for deer. I think the lowers made to handle the biggerrounds like the 243, 260 and such are made differently like the AR-10.That is unless you mean using the 223 for deer usingsomething like a TSX or something.
There is also the 6.5 grendel and 6.8 SPC cartridge, very capable for deer...
